Investigo is partnered with a high-growth, PE-backed Financial Services business undergoing a significant period of transformation. The Group is seeking a qualified Financial Accountant to join on a fixed-term contract until April 2026. This role will be central to ensuring robust financial control, accurate reporting, and providing support through ongoing change and growth.
Key Responsibilities
* Financial Control – Maintain general ledger postings and deliver accurate, timely financial reporting for both internal and external stakeholders. Develop and enhance accounting procedures and controls (e.g. segregation of duties, balance sheet reconciliations). Assist in the preparation of statutory/audited accounts and regulatory returns.
* Treasury Management – Manage cash flow, banking activities, and identify/mitigate FX risk.
* Finance Systems & Change – Support infrastructure improvements to meet books and records obligations. Implement systems and processes to enable compliance with a controls-based audit environment.
* Audit – Assist with internal and external audit processes to ensure timely and accurate completion.
* M&A Support – Contribute to due diligence and other M&A-related activities when required.
* Compliance – Ensure adherence to the firm's regulatory, risk management, and operational frameworks.
Skills & Experience
* Recognised accountancy qualification (ACA, ACCA, CPA, or equivalent)
* Strong technical expertise across financial reporting, accounting, tax, treasury, and FX
* Confident working with senior stakeholders, including Boards, executives, auditors, regulators, and investors
* Strong analytical and critical thinking skills, with the ability to thrive under pressure
* Excellent written, verbal, and presentation communication skills
* Proven experience managing change and implementing new systems or processes
* Project and change management experience
* Strong IT and finance systems knowledge
